Standard Life in Edinburgh seeks an experienced Investment Operations lead to coordinate a key migration project migrating customer policies to a new policy administration platform.

You will liaise with internal and external stakeholders, produce requirements, test scopes and sign‑offs with senior leaders.

Bring investment operations expertise, guide teams, challenge existing processes and drive solutions.
